Problem

Existing display devices have a cumbersome appearance due to peripheral frames covering non-image displaying areas, which become discontinuous when multiple devices are combined to form a larger screen.

Innovation Solution

A display device design featuring a pixel circuit substrate, light emitting devices, a driver circuit substrate on the backside, and an electrically conductive adhesion layer between the substrates, allowing for a narrow border or borderless display by positioning the driver circuit substrate behind the pixel circuit substrate and using wider connection terminals and adhesion layers for effective electrical connection.

Data Source

PatentUS10854681B2Display device
Publication Date: 2020.12.01 AU OPTRONICS CORP

AI summary

A display device includes a pixel circuit substrate, a plurality of light emitting devices, a driver circuit substrate, a plurality of connection terminals, and an electrically conductive adhesion layer. The light emitting devices are electrically connected to the pixel circuit substrate. The driver circuit substrate is disposed on a back side of the pixel circuit substrate. The connection terminals electrically connect the driver circuit substrate to the pixel circuit substrate. The electrically conductive adhesion layer is disposed between the pixel circuit substrate and the driver circuit substrate.
